Article Oncology

Global cancer statistics 2020: GLOBOCAN estimates of incidence and mortality worldwide for 36 cancers in 185 countries

Hyuna Sung et al.

Summary: The global cancer burden in 2020 saw an estimated 19.3 million new cancer cases and almost 10.0 million cancer deaths. Female breast cancer surpassed lung cancer as the most commonly diagnosed cancer, while lung cancer remained the leading cause of cancer death. These trends are expected to rise in 2040, with transitioning countries experiencing a larger increase compared to transitioned countries due to demographic changes and risk factors associated with globalization and a growing economy. Efforts to improve cancer prevention measures and provision of cancer care in transitioning countries will be crucial for global cancer control.

Article Oncology

First Case Report of Pregnancy on Alectinib in a Woman With Metastatic ALK-Rearranged Lung Cancer: A Case Report

Giovanna Scarfone et al.

Summary: This case report presents a female patient with ALK-rearranged metastatic lung adenocarcinoma who became pregnant while receiving alectinib treatment. With the collaborative effort of a multidisciplinary team, the patient continued the study drug throughout pregnancy and delivered a healthy baby girl. Both maternal and fetal parameters remained normal during the pregnancy, and the baby showed no developmental anomalies during the first 20 months of life. After 32 months from diagnosis, the mother is doing well and in partial remission.
